EMODnet Physics – RVFL_001 - The page presents the sea surface currents field are recorded by High Frequency Radars. HFR is a unique technology mapping the speed and direction of ocean surface currents in near real time (along with other variables) over wide areas with high spatial and temporal resolution. Currents in the ocean are equivalent to winds in the atmosphere because they move things from one location to another. These currents carry nutrients as well pollutants, so it is important to know the currents for ecological and economic reasons. The page integrates the European HFR node product (see also
http://eurogoos.eu/high-frequency-radar-task-team/
) with international sources of HFR data (Global HFR network).
